Hoodia Side Effects

Many companies that are selling hoodia products claim that there are no side effects to hoodia. However, there are some side effects you should know before you decide to begin taking hoodia for weight loss.

Hoodia is an extreme appetite suppressant. Since hoodia is such a great appetite suppressant, it may cause trouble for diabetics. Studies show that the reason hoodia works so well at suppressing the appetite is because it tells the brain that the body has enough blood sugar. Diabetics should not take hoodia. It could impair your judgment and cause you to have serious medical issues.

Another issue with hoodia is the fact that not only does it make you less hungry, but you also never feel thirsty. The reason this is a problem is because it has actually caused people to forget to drink and then they became dehydrated. If you decide to begin taking hoodia, make sure you count how many glasses of water you drink per day. You need to be mindful of taking in enough water. If you take certain medications, it may block absorption into the body. This is just one of the allegations made against hoodia. It hasn't been proven.

If you are pregnant or nursing, do not take hoodia. Not enough is known about hoodia and pregnancy at this time.

If you have liver disease or kidney disease, do not take hoodia.
